3. Ninja Creami Keto Mocha Fudge Ice Cream Ingredients

Ready to gather your ingredients? Let’s divide them by component so you’re fully prepped.

For the Ice Cream Base:

  • 1 cup unsweetened almond milk (or coconut milk for creaminess)
  • ½ cup heavy cream
  • ¼ cup powdered allulose (or erythritol/monk fruit blend)
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• 2 tsp instant coffee granules or 1 shot of espresso
  • 1 tbsp cocoa powder (unsweetened)
  • Pinch of salt
  • 1 scoop collagen powder or unflavored whey protein (optional—for creamier texture)

For the Keto Fudge Swirl:

  • 2 tbsp butter
  • 2 tbsp unsweetened cocoa powder
  • 2 tbsp allulose
  • 1 tbsp heavy cream
  • A pinch of salt
  • ¼ tsp vanilla extract

Simple, right? These are all pantry staples if you’re already living that keto life.

4. Step-by-Step Instructions: Let’s Make It Happen

Let’s walk through the full process, from mixing to spinning.

Step 1: Make the Base

Start by mixing all the base ingredients:

  • In a blender or bowl, combine almond milk, heavy cream, sweetener, cocoa, instant coffee, vanilla, and salt.
  • Mix until everything is fully dissolved. If using collagen or whey, make sure it’s blended smooth.

Pour the mixture into the Ninja Creami pint container. Seal and freeze for at least 24 hours until solid.

Step 2: Prepare the Keto Fudge Swirl

While your base freezes, whip up the fudge:

  • Melt butter in a small pan.
  • Add cocoa powder, sweetener, and cream.
  • Stir until thick and smooth.
  • Remove from heat and stir in vanilla.
  • Let it cool, then store in the fridge.

Step 3: Spin the Ice Cream

Once frozen solid:

  • Remove the pint from the freezer and place it in the Ninja Creami.
  • Spin using the “Lite Ice Cream” or “Creamy” mode.
  • If the texture seems crumbly, add 1–2 tbsp almond milk and re-spin.

Step 4: Swirl in the Fudge

Once the texture is smooth:

  • Create a small tunnel in the center.
  • Spoon in your keto fudge (about 2 tbsp).
  • Use the “Mix-In” mode to swirl it into the base.

Done! Now grab a spoon—or two—and enjoy.

5. Tips for Perfect Creaminess

Wondering how to get that store-bought texture with clean, keto ingredients?

Follow these tips:

  • Use heavy cream: It adds fat and smooth texture.
  • Avoid too much erythritol: It can crystallize and cause graininess. Allulose or monk fruit blends are smoother.
  • Re-spin when needed: The Ninja Creami lets you tweak the texture—don’t be afraid to re-spin for perfection.
  • Add protein or collagen: It boosts the creaminess without carbs.

6. Nutritional Breakdown (Per Serving)

Here’s a quick snapshot of what you’re eating:

NutrientAmount (approx)
Calories210
Net Carbs3g
Fat18g
Protein4g
Sugar (added)0g

Makes about 2 servings per pint. You can double the recipe for more—just prep an extra pint container.

7. Storage and Leftovers: Can You Refreeze?

Yes, but there’s a trick.

Once spun, you can refreeze the pint—but it’ll harden. To reuse:

  • Let it sit at room temperature for 10–15 minutes.
  • Add a splash of almond milk.
  • Re-spin using “Creamy” mode.

8. Want to Customize It? Here’s How

This mocha fudge recipe is versatile. Want to make it your own? Try these swaps:

  • Add crunch: Toss in chopped walnuts or keto chocolate chips using the Mix-In mode.
  • Make it dairy-free: Use coconut cream instead of heavy cream.
  • Amp up coffee flavor: Use espresso powder instead of instant coffee.
  • Make it extra chocolatey: Stir in unsweetened dark chocolate chunks.

9.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q: Is Ninja Creami really worth it for keto eaters?
Absolutely. It lets you enjoy high-fat, low-carb frozen treats without mystery ingredients.

Q: Why is my ice cream crumbly?
That’s normal after the first spin. Just add a tablespoon or two of liquid (like almond milk) and re-spin.

Q: Can I use erythritol instead of allulose?
Yes, but the texture might be a bit icier. Allulose tends to mimic sugar better in frozen desserts.

Q: What if I don’t like coffee?
Skip the mocha! Use the same base and leave out the coffee for a creamy chocolate fudge version.
